They're really just for emergency use, when you are starving and there are no other options available.  This should be pretty rare, as there are almost always better options available if you're at home or near a grocery store.

They are tasty, as close to a candy bar as you can get with whole30 ingredients. They will keep your sugar dragon roaring. They're heavy on nuts, which can be hard on the digestion. You'd really be better off not having any at all during your whole30.
